    Abstract: The present invention includes a method and a system for creating Web Ontology Language (OWL) ontology from a Universal Business Language (UBL) process diagram. The UBL process diagram includes one or more processes, one or more partitions, one or more activities, one or more objects, an initial node, and a final node. At least one of the processes, the partitions, the activities, and the objects are extracted from the UBL process diagram. A first OWL class, a second OWL class, and a third OWL class are created corresponding to the processes, partitions, and objects, respectively. Thereafter, an object property is created corresponding to each of the activities, the initial node, and the final node. Finally, the first OWL class, the second OWL class, the third OWL class, and each of the created object property are added to obtain the OWL ontology.

    Abstract: A method for managing the Search Engine Optimization (SEO) content of web pages is disclosed. In one embodiment, such a method includes providing a set of web pages organized in a hierarchical structure. Each web page has an SEO content pattern associated therewith. The method establishes an inheritance scheme for the hierarchical structure such that the SEO content patterns of parent web pages are inherited by children web pages. The method further enables a user to override the inheritance scheme for selected web pages such that the SEO content patterns of the selected web pages override the SEO content patterns of their respective parent web pages. A corresponding apparatus and computer program product are also disclosed.

    Abstract: A method and system for sorting data of an input file containing multiple records associated with multiple tables of a database. The multiple records include key values. The key values are segmented into ranges of key values for each table. Each range of key values for each table is a segment having a segment value. A block number, which contains a unique permutation of the segment values of the segments, is generated. The segment values denote the ranges of key values encompassing multiple key values in each record. A sort key value for each record is ascertained, based on the generated block number for each record, and added to each record. The multiple records are sorted according to the sort key values in the multiple records. The sorted multiple records are stored in an output file. The selected multiple key values include all key values that satisfy a condition.

    Abstract: Updating a second cluster server that backs up a first cluster server includes retrieving a first metadata file from a first cluster server. The first metadata file includes a first ordered list of block identifiers for data blocks stored on a first plurality of block servers. The updating also includes retrieving a second metadata file from a second cluster server. The second metadata file includes a second ordered list of block identifiers for data blocks stored on a second plurality of block servers. The updating also includes comparing the first metadata file to the second metadata file to determine a difference list. The difference list includes block identifiers from the first ordered list that differ from block identifiers of the second ordered list. The updating also includes sending, to the first cluster server, a request for data blocks associated with the block identifiers from the difference list.
